Stumholmen is a part of the World Heritage city of Karlskrona, on this walk you get to experience Karlskrona's maritime history up close.

On Stumholmen, you will find an exciting history and military buildings from the 18th century to the mid-20th century, innovative urban development, pleasant recreational areas, and the Naval Museum.

For over 300 years, Stumholmen was a vital part of the Karlskrona Naval Base and was also known as the "Navy's pantry." The Slup & Barkasskjulet, now part of the Naval Museum, offers a new experience this year – here, you can join a rope-making session with a ropemaker or a World Heritage guide, just as it has been done for centuries at the Rope-making Alley in Karlskrona.

The guided tour is a collaboration between Karlskrona Municipality and VHFK (Varvshistoriska föreningen i Karlskrona). The Varvshistoriska föreningen i Karlskrona has, among other things, developed the ropemaking activity on the ropemaking alley over several years.
